Your team should understand your vision. Try using your mission as a compass and integrating the company values into your everyday experience. Communicate this with your team and let them step into their roles to meet goals. This lets you build a stronger bond with the team.

Don’t lose your moral compass. Be sure you can make peace with your decisions. If you anticipate feeling badly about a potential choice, steer clear of it. Even if others would make the decision anyway, you have to do what feels right to you.

When leading, focus on the workers and work will get done. Learn to encourage and inspire employees who work with you. Instead of placing too much focus on individual tasks, motivate the team to perform well.

When you are a leader, it is important that they know regularly they are appreciated. Just write them a quick note saying thank you for the hard work. That brief acknowledgment can turn a whole day around, boosting a mood, and is absolutely free.

Prepare yourself thoroughly prior to meeting with the team. Try to imagine what kinds of questions they’re going to be asking you. Think of answers for the questions. Providing the right answers will earn you respect. Doing this will also save you time.
